The Rise of Digital Product Creation
Digital product creation has grown significantly over the past decade, fueled by the rise of online marketplaces, social media, and remote work. In 2026, the landscape has matured further, with more individuals and businesses embracing digital-first strategies. From printable planners and templates to online courses and software tools, digital products offer a scalable, low-cost way to reach global audiences while maintaining creative control.
However, the success of these products often hinges on more than just having a great idea. Many creators struggle with the initial steps—defining their niche, validating their concept, designing a product, and launching it effectively.
